Manikpur Population - Muzaffarpur, Bihar

Manikpur is a medium size village located in Baruraj (Motipur) Block of Muzaffarpur district, Bihar with total 208 families residing. The Manikpur village has population of 1140 of which 601 are males while 539 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Manikp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 173 which makes up 15.18 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Manikpur village is 897 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Manikpur as per census is 1060, higher than Bihar average of 935.

Manikp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Manikpur village was 63.08 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Manikpur Male literacy stands at 72.73 % while female literacy rate was 52.00 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Manikpur village of Muzaffarpur district.

Work Profile

In Manikpur village out of total population, 417 were engaged in work activities. 25.66 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 74.34 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 417 workers engaged in Main Work, 81 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 5 were Agricultural labourer.
